Is Cypress College an accredited school?
Cypress College received reaffirmation of its accreditation from the Accrediting Commission for Community and Junior Colleges (ACCJC), Western Association of Schools and Colleges (WASC).

What GPA do you need to get into Cypress College?
a 2.5 GPA or higher
Have completed at least 12 units earning a 2.5 GPA or higher. Have waited a minimum of twelve months since your last substandard grade. No more than 24 units of substandard grades (D, F, NC, and NP) may be disregarded. Bring in all (official) transcripts from other colleges at the time of your application.

How long is Fullerton nursing program?
The Traditional BSN Pathway must be completed full-time throughout the course of either 8 semesters (4 years) or 10 semesters (5 years). This does not include summer or winter (intersession), as summer and intersession are optional.
How much is the nursing program at Cal State Fullerton?
California State University–Fullerton is a public school. The Nursing Department has an application fee of $70 for U.S. residents. Tuition for the master’s program at the Nursing Department is Full-time: $8,390 per year (in-state) and $17,894 per year (out-of-state).
Is it hard to get into Cypress College?
Cypress College is an open admission policy institution. Open admission colleges typically have few admission thresholds and will admit all applicants so long as certain minimum requirements are met. New admission is often granted continually throughout the year.
